Q: Is 5,952,961 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,952,961 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,952,961 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5952961 can be evenly divided by 1 7 31 49 217 1,519 3,919 27,433 121,489 192,031 850,423 and 5,952,961, with no remainder.

Since 5,952,961 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,952,961, it is not a prime number.
